About BPAC-103 Course

BPAC-103 is a course focused on administrative system at union level, helping students build conceptual clarity and practical understanding.

The BPAC-103 assignments evaluate analytical thinking, structured writing, and subject knowledge.

The IGNOU BPAC-103 Assignments are a mandatory component for students enrolled in the Bachelor of Arts (Honours) Public Administration (BAPAH) programme. This course, titled Administrative System at the Union Level, requires students to submit a tutor-marked assignment (TMA) to their respective study centers. The IGNOU BPAC-103 Assignments serve as a continuous evaluation tool, helping students grasp the complexities of the Indian central administrative framework before appearing for the term-end examinations.

Completing the IGNOU BPAC-103 Assignments effectively is crucial as they carry a 30% weightage in the final grade. Students must download the official assignment question papers from the Indira Gandhi National Open University portal and follow the specific guidelines regarding word limits and submission deadlines. Ensuring that the BPAC-103 assignment are submitted on time is essential for being eligible to sit for the theory exams and for the timely update of the student grade card.


BPAC-103 assignment Overview

The BPAC-103 assignments are designed to test the analytical and descriptive skills of the learners. The assignment booklet generally contains three categories of questions: long-answer questions, medium-answer questions, and short-answer notes. By working on the BPAC-103 assignment, students gain a deeper understanding of the constitutional framework, the role of the President, Prime Minister, and the various ministries within the Union Government of India.

Adhering to the official IGNOU guidelines is the most important part of this process. Students should use A4 size ruled paper for writing their BPAC-103 assignment and must ensure their handwriting is legible. It is important to note that the BPAC-103 assignment must be the original work of the student; plagiarized or copied content from study materials or other students will lead to rejection or zero marks in the evaluation process.

How to Submit BPAC-103 assignment

The submission of BPAC-103 assignment can be done either physically at your Study Centre or through an online portal if your Regional Centre has enabled that facility. Before submitting, ensure that your BPAC-103 assignment have a properly filled cover page containing your name, enrollment number, programme code, and study center code. It is highly recommended to keep a scanned copy or a photocopy of the handwritten BPAC-103 assignment for your personal records.

Once you submit your BPAC-103 assignments, always ask for an acknowledgment receipt from the Study Centre coordinator. This receipt is your only proof of submission in case the marks for the BPAC-103 assignments are not updated in the system within the expected timeframe. After submission, it usually takes 2 to 4 months for the status to reflect on the official IGNOU assignment status portal, which students should monitor regularly to ensure their academic progress is on track.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the passing mark for BPAC-103 assignment?
Students must secure at least 35% marks in their BPAC-103 assignment to be considered pass in the continuous evaluation component. However, consistent high performance is advised for a better overall grade.

2. Can I submit BPAC-103 assignments after the deadline?
Generally, the university provides extensions for the submission of BPAC-103 assignment. However, it is strictly advised to follow the dates mentioned in the official notification to avoid any issues during the exam form filling process.

3. Where can I check the status of my BPAC-103 assignments?
You can check the submission status of your BPAC-103 assignments on the official IGNOU Student Evaluation Division portal by entering your enrollment number and programme code after the evaluation period.

4. Is it possible to resubmit BPAC-103 assignments if I fail?
Yes, if a student fails in the BPAC-103 assignment or is unable to submit them on time, they must download the question paper for the next available session and submit a fresh assignment to proceed with their course.

5. Should I use a spiral binder for BPAC-103 assignments?
No, IGNOU typically recommends using a simple tag or folder to secure the pages of your BPAC-103 assignment. Avoid using heavy plastic folders or expensive binding as they are often discarded during the bulk evaluation process.
